Transaction 142e87782cf3babfbc2c95f440270724a2a5f91ba3167df2c4bc0db010724295
1 Input
1 Output
-
142e87782cf3babfbc2c95f440270724a2a5f91ba3167df2c4bc0db010724295:0
- value
- 2888359
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ba627aea11cb1efc5a09f934933d14a050d9d4e OP_EQUALVERIFY OP_CHECKSIG
- address
- 14yo6uGEsarQsB71rDiAUCASaWmz7ftntv